Output c2a64204c878dedbbe1275c7dee7c39999de7c2a176ba25a13cebb6aa6802864:0

value
33289446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d4d86e0f086de8c466cbcfddf5a8f18c86452d5 OP_EQUAL
address
3EaA5FdzNRdPx14K6xeun2E8hiHHmwr3LN
transaction
c2a64204c878dedbbe1275c7dee7c39999de7c2a176ba25a13cebb6aa6802864
confirmations
480461
spent
true